
The demand for different shirt sizes is given in the table.
Size $38$ $39$ $40$ $41$ $42$ $43$ $44$ No. of persons $26$ $36$ $20$ $15$ $13$ $7$ $5$
Find the modal shirt size.
${\text{(A)}}$$39$
$\left( {\text{B}} \right)$$40$
$\left( {\text{C}} \right)$$44$
$\left( {\text{D}} \right)$$42$
Size | $38$ | $39$ | $40$ | $41$ | $42$ | $43$ | $44$ |
No. of persons | $26$ | $36$ | $20$ | $15$ | $13$ | $7$ | $5$ |

Hint: Here, we have to find mode we should look through the observation which occurs the most. In all problems with ungrouped data (i.e.) observations which have no class limits, the mode of the problem should be found in the following method. Just look through the question once or twice, the answer is very simple.
Complete step-by-step solution:
From the above table, the size of different shirts and the respective number of persons purchased the shirts are also given.
So, it is clear that the highest number of people has occurred in the shirt size \[39\] compared with other shirt sizes.
(i. e) $36$ persons demanded the shirt size of $39$
Other shirt sizes such as $38$,$40$,$41$,$42$,$43$ & $44$ have lower frequencies than the shirt size of $39$.
We have the formula for mode as mentioned below,
Mode = highest occurring observation.
$\therefore $ Mode = $39$
So, the modal shirt size is $39$
Hence, the correct answer is (A).
Note: Here, the modal shirt size has been found by the No. of persons demanding the shirts. Similar methods can be applied to find the mode value of other problems.
Mode is an important tool in statistics which is used to interpret data in a relevant manner.
Although it is an essential thing in statistics, mode can be found by simple strategies.
There may be a multimodal data in which there will be more than one mode in a group of observations. So, their answer will be one or more values.
